Organisation profile
The Business Informatics working group, in particular Data Science, headed by Prof Dr Burkhardt Funk, is dedicated to the development and application of data-driven methods for decision support in companies and public institutions.
Main research areas
The research focus lies on the use of data science and machine learning to analyse large amounts of data in order to optimise processes and decisions. A central topic is the development of intelligent systems that support decisions through data-based predictions. Fields of application include healthcare and various operational functions (e.g. marketing, accounting). We have developed approaches for predicting the effectiveness and personalisation of healthcare interventions, methods for extracting knowledge from documents (business documents, scientific papers) and for optimal budget allocation in marketing.
